Finding Association Publications Online

You can look for the full-text of an organization's publications (magazines and journals) on their website. You can also search the e-Journals to which the library subscribes.

  1. Organization webpages.  Many professional organizations provide full-text of their articles for free.  They may provide different access for association members and non-members.  Check their webpages to see what is available. 
  2. E-Journal Search.  The library subscribes to paper or electronic versions of many association magazines and scholarly journals.
  • Search the magazine or journal title via the e-Journal search on the library webpage. 

 

  • Scan and view entire issues of magazines and journals.  Scanning article titles (like a table of contents) provides you with an overview of what is being discussed within the organization/profession.
     
  • Search for a topic within the publication and then read the articles online.
